Maya El Khawand is a Lebanese Architect and Urban Designer. She completed her double masters at the “Académie Libanaise des Beaux-Arts” (ALBA) in Beirut, Lebanon. She did various architecture internships in France, Lebanon and an internship in Switzerland at the Laboratory of Urban Sociology at the EPFL, where she gained knowledge in urban mobility and urban sociology.

Her interests revolve around cities and improving the quality of urban life focusing on mobility, sociology, sustainability and accessibility.

She will be working on the ESR7 at the University Gustave Eiffel in Paris. Her thesis is about reducing mobility dependency in rural urban areas tackling mobility justice, accessibility, motility and mobility dependency. Her thesis project is based on the comparison of four study perimeters in France and Switzerland.
